RESURRECTION GLORY!
The women awoke in the darkness of the pre-dawn morning. They gathered the spices they had prepared and crept through the silent streets to the garden tomb.
There – expecting a tomb officially sealed – they found a tomb burst open, with heaven’s energy! Empty of the body they so earnestly sought!
They expected soldiers who they would have to bribe to gain entry to embalm the body that was so precious to them. But instead, a silent garden met their furtive glances and the stone – doorway size – stood ajar – allowing entry and EXIT!
As they came closer, brilliance beyond daybreak and sunrise struck their anxious faces. Two angels sat – on the place where 36 hours earlier His body had been laid.
In voices sounding human yet resounding with the echoes of eternity, they asked: “WHY ARE YOU LOOKING FOR THE LIVING AMONG THE DEAD?”
Could this be? His body not stolen away by vandals as they suspected? But a miracle of renewed life and resurrection to that bruised and battered body they had come to honour?
“He is not here!” “He is risen!” With those words the angels shouted the echoes of angelic voices over Bethlehem’s fields 33 years before!
“Go tell His disciples” – news too good to hold to themselves!
Back through the quiet streets they ran! Cloaks flapping, feet flying, hearts racing – hands pound on barred and locked door where His disciples huddled inside in fear and despair!
Peter and John ran ahead back to the tomb with the breathless women following.
They too saw the empty tomb – the wrappings for His body neatly folded. They too saw an angel who directed them to go back home to Galilee where Jesus would meet them later.
Everyone rushed out of the garden – eager to share the earth changing news! Only Mary remained. Kneeling and weeping. How could it be – had His body been stolen away? Her heart was overflowing with the pain of the past few days.
When she heard a step behind her, she thought it was the gardener and out of her bruised and aching heart came the request: “Sir, if you know where His body is, please tell me so I can go and see it”?
Then to her ears came the sound of the voice she loved so well! With tones of clarity, she heard Him speak her name – “Mary”.
Her heart leapt! It was her Lord – He was alive! He was there beside her in the garden! He Himself gave her the task to go and tell – to proclaim “JESUS LIVES”!
DEATH IS SWALLOWED UP IN VICTORY! LIFE WILL NEVER BE THE SAME!
Hallelujah! The Lord is risen – He is risen indeed!
